Determining Lead Threats



Identifying lead hazards is a vital very first action in minimizing the threats linked with lead exposure. Lead, a toxic metal, can be present in various environmental mediums, including paint, soil, water, and dirt.


The initial phase in identifying lead hazards involves understanding common lead sources within the constructed setting. Frameworks constructed prior to 1978 are specifically prone as a result of the common usage of lead-based paint during that period. Additionally, soil contamination can take place from deteriorating outside paint, commercial exhausts, or historical use leaded gasoline.


Another substantial resource is lead piping and pipes fixtures, which can leach lead into alcohol consumption water. Durable goods such as toys, porcelains, and imported items might likewise contain unsafe lead levels. Notably, occupational settings and pastimes including lead can track contaminants right into homes.


Evaluation and Testing



When attending to lead risks, efficient evaluation and testing are vital. First analysis typically entails a visual assessment to recognize prospective lead resources, such as weakening paint or polluted dirt.

One of the key testing approaches is X-Ray Fluorescence (XRF) analysis, which enables non-destructive dimension of lead content in numerous materials - Lead Paint Removal Company. XRF is extremely effective in supplying immediate outcomes, hence assisting in punctual decision-making. Furthermore, laboratory-based approaches, such as atomic absorption spectroscopy, are employed for dirt and water examples to guarantee specific quantification of lead levels




Dust wipe tasting is an additional critical method, especially in household setups. By collecting samples from floors, windowsills, and other surface areas, this approach gives understandings into potential exposure dangers. Moreover, dirt screening around structure borders is necessary to spot lead contamination that might present dangers, specifically to youngsters.




Safe Elimination Treatments



Upon finishing detailed analysis and screening, carrying out risk-free removal procedures is the next crucial stage in addressing lead risks. This procedure makes sure that lead-contaminated products are properly and securely removed, reducing risk to both workers and homeowners. The initial step involves separating the damaged area using plastic bed linen and appropriate sealing techniques to stop the spread of lead dirt.


Workers must wear suitable personal safety devices (PPE), including respirators, handwear covers, and non reusable coveralls, to reduce exposure. Employing specialized devices and wet browse this site approaches, such as wet sanding or utilizing HEPA-filtered vacuums, lowers the dispersion of lead particles. It is critical to prevent completely dry sanding or unpleasant blowing up, as these methods can produce hazardous lead dirt.


Waste disposal is an additional important part; all polluted products should be firmly nabbed and classified according to EPA and local laws. Additionally, detailed cleaning of the workspace with HEPA vacuums and damp wiping makes sure the elimination of residual lead bits.


Post-Removal Confirmation





Confirmation of effective lead elimination, known as post-removal verification, is critical to guarantee the safety and security and habitability of the remediated location. This useful site process includes a collection of thorough assessments and tests created to identify any residual lead bits that might posture my review here health risks. The preliminary action commonly consists of a visual inspection to evaluate the completion and high quality of the removal job. This examination ensures that all known sources of lead have been dealt with and that no visible indications of contamination stay.


Following the visual inspection, ecological tasting is carried out. This includes collecting dust, dirt, and occasionally water examples from the remediated area. Certified laboratories analyze these examples to determine lead levels, ensuring they drop listed below the security thresholds developed by regulative bodies such as the Epa (EPA)


In enhancement, air top quality testing may be done to detect airborne lead particles, especially in situations where extensive lead-based paint elimination or renovation has actually happened. The results of these examinations supply quantitative information verifying that the lead levels are within permitted limitations.


Ultimately, post-removal confirmation functions as a critical checkpoint, confirming the efficiency of the lead reduction efforts and safeguarding the health and wellness of residents and site visitors.

Guaranteeing lead has actually been effectively gotten rid of is only part of the remedy; positive measures and regular maintenance are necessary to protect against future contamination. Routine inspections and surveillance are important to identify any kind of early indicators of lead risks. Implementing a detailed maintenance strategy that includes regular testing of paint, water, and dirt can help in finding any rebirth of lead presence.


A vital safety net includes making use of lead-safe certified specialists for any kind of remodelling, fixing, or painting tasks. These specialists are trained in methods that minimize lead dust and particles. In addition, maintaining colored surface areas to avoid cracking or peeling off is essential, as weakening paint can launch lead fragments into the atmosphere.


Educational campaigns targeting home proprietors and lessees regarding the risks of lead and the value of reporting any kind of potential risks can additionally boost preventative initiatives. Regular cleaning using HEPA vacuums and wet mopping methods can dramatically lower lead dirt accumulation.
